  • Publication number: 20240119632
    Abstract: A method and a system for calibrating cameras of a multichannel medical visualization system, including capturing a capturing region respectively imaged via channels of the multichannel medical visualization system by a respective camera, determining a magnification center for each of the channels, setting at least two magnification levels of a common mechanical magnification optical unit, identifying an image region which does not move or which moves the least across the magnification levels for each of the channels in image representations which are captured, and, proceeding from the respectively determined magnification centers, defining an image portion for each of the channels in the captured image representations with the respectively identified magnification center as the center, and restricting an output of the captured image representations at all magnification levels to the image portion defined for the respective channel.
    Type: Application
    Filed: September 29, 2023
    Publication date: April 11, 2024
    Inventors: Richard BAEUMER, Marco WOERNER, Henrike VON HUELSEN
  • Publication number: 20230316573
    Abstract: The invention relates to a method for operating a medical microscope, in particular in the field, with an interchange and/or a misalignment of at least one component of the medical microscope being followed by an identification of the interchanged and/or misaligned at least one component, with required adjustment measures and/or calibration measures being determined in automated fashion using the identified at least one interchanged and/or misaligned component as a starting point, and with the determined required adjustment measures and/or calibration measures being carried out. Furthermore, the invention relates to a medical microscope arrangement.
    Type: Application
    Filed: January 24, 2023
    Publication date: October 5, 2023
    Inventors: Felicia WALZ, Dominik SCHERER, Stefan SAUR, Marco WOERNER, Lars STOPPE, Christian PLATT

  • Publication number: 20230236405
    Abstract: The invention relates to a method for operating a stereoscopic medical microscope, wherein deteriorated and/or invalid calibration data are recognized, wherein for this purpose mutually corresponding image representations of at least one feature arranged in capture regions of cameras of a stereo camera system of the medical microscope are captured by means of the cameras, the captured image representations are evaluated by means of feature-based image processing, wherein the at least one feature is recognized in this case in the captured image representations and a misalignment and/or a decalibration of the cameras of the stereo camera system are/is recognized on the basis of the at least one feature recognized; and wherein at least one measure is carried out depending on an evaluation result. Furthermore, the invention relates to a medical microscope.
    Type: Application
    Filed: January 24, 2023
    Publication date: July 27, 2023
    Inventors: Felicia WALZ, Dominik SCHERER, Stefan SAUR, Marco WOERNER, Lars STOPPE, Christian PLATT
